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Our technicians will arrive quickly to assess the damage and contain the affected area to prevent further water intrusion. We’ll use specialized equipment to remove standing water and begin the drying process.

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use advanced equipment to dry your living room quickly and efficiently. Our desiccant dehumidifiers will remove excess moisture from the air, while our air movers will circulate warm air to speed up the drying process.

Step 3: Cleaning and Disinfection

Once the drying process is complete, we’ll clean and disinfect the affected area to remove any remaining moisture and prevent mold growth. We’ll use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to ensure your living room is safe and healthy.

Step 4: Restoration and Repair

Finally, we’ll restore your living room to its original condition. We’ll repair any damaged walls, replace any affected flooring, and restore your home’s original appearance.

Warning Signs You Need Living Room Water Damage Restoration

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Look out for these warning signs in your living room: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ors in your living room can be a sign of water damage. If you notice a persistent musty smell, it’s time to call us.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s time to call us.

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Water stains on your wal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any discoloration or staining, it’s time to call us.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your paint or wallpaper, it’s time to call us.

Visible Water Damage on Walls or Ceilings

Visible water damage on your walls or ceilings can be a sign of a bigger problem. If you notice any water stains, warping, or buckling, it’s time to call us.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old or mildew growth in your living room can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any mold or mildew, it’s time to call us.

Living Room Water Damage Restoration Cost in Somerset, WI

The cost of living room water damage restoration varies based on the severity and size of the affected area. Our prices range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age and the equipment needed to restore your home. The cost of restoration also depends on the local conditions in Somerset, WI, and the surrounding communities.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$200-$500 Severity of damage and size of affected area
Drying and Dehumidification $500-$1,500 Size of affected area and equipment needed
Cleaning and Disinfection $200-$500 Size of affected area and equipment needed
Restoration and Repair $1,000-$3,000 Severity of damage and size of affected area
Moisture Testing and Inspection $100-$300 Size of affected area and equipment needed
Equipment Rental and Delivery $100-$500 Size of affected area and equipment needed
